The Health Sciences Program at the University of Hartford prepares you for professional or graduate study in health-related fields, such as occupational therapy, speech pathology, or public health.
The pre-professional track of the health science program prepares you for professional or graduate study in such health-related fields as dentistry, allopathic or osteopathic medicine, optometry, chiropractic, or podiatry.
The curriculum includes prerequisite coursework for many graduate programs in health-related fields, such as biology, physics, and chemistry. The curriculum can also be tailored to meet your needs if you are interested in graduate programs with unique prerequisites (for example, two semesters of physics or a semester of biochemistry).
Additionally, you will take health science courses that introduce you to a wide range of health-related topics, such as Educational Strategies for Healthcare Professionals, The Human Genome, Introduction to Public Health, and Cardiovascular Disease. These courses can help you determine your long-term career goals by exposing you to a range of healthcare professional roles.

Medical imaging is a vital component of the health care system. As a medical imaging professional, the radiologic technologist (or radiographer) employs x-rays and other forms of energy to assist in the diagnosis and treatment of illness and injury. Our four-year program leads to a certificate of completion in Radiologic Technology and a Bachelor of Science Degree in Health Science. Students also may choose to specialize in Computed Tomography (CT), Magnetic Resonance Imaging (MRI), or Ultrasound (US) .

The new facility will ensure that Okanagan College continues to train students for health science careers that are in demand throughout the province.
The Province of BC will contribute $15.4 million and Okanagan College will contribute $3.5 million toward the construction of the new facility that will be located beside the existing Laboratory Building. The Laboratory Building currently accommodates the bachelor of science in nursing program, university transfer science programs and engineering technology programs.
The new 2,800 square-metre (30,000 square-foot) Health Sciences Centre will be an integrated learning centre that will include programs such as practical nursing, pharmacy technician, human service worker and early childhood education.

Herbs and Natural Supplements: An Evidence-Based Guide 3rd edition presents evidence-based information on the most popular herbs, nutrients and food supplements used across Australia and New Zealand. Organised alphabetically by common name, each herb or nutrient listed includes information such as daily intake, main actions/indications, adverse reactions, contraindications and precautions, safety in pregnancy, and more.
Key Features
* provides current, evidence-based information on herbal, nutritional and food supplements used in Australia and New Zealand
* user-friendly, well indexed, and organised by A-Z herbal monographs, making information easy to find
* appendices offer important additional information for the safe use of herbal and nutritional supplements, including a list of poison centres, associations, manufacturers plus much more.
* clear and comprehensive tables including Herb/Natural Supplement – Drug Interactions and Pharmacological Actions of all Herbs and Natural Supplements listed
* a glossary of terms

The Department of Health Sciences and Nursing offers a number of programs specifically designed to meet the needs of a dynamic healthcare system. Clinical programs prepare students for national certification in a variety of health professions. In addition, the general health science major provides the foundation necessary for students to go on to medical and other health-related graduate programs. Our nursing programs, however, are designed for nurses considering advanced study who already hold a professional license as a registered nurse.
